#! /bin/bash
# Do some prep work
command -v git >/dev/null 2>&1 || {
echo >&2 "We require git for this script to run, but it's not installed. Aborting."
exit 1
}
command -v curl >/dev/null 2>&1 || {
echo >&2 "We require curl for this script to run, but it's not installed. Aborting."
exit 1
}
# get start time
START_BUILD=$(date +"%s")
# use UTC+00:00 time also called zulu
START_DATE=$(TZ=":ZULU" date +"%m/%d/%Y @ %R (UTC)")
# BOT name
BOT_NAME="Octosync v1.0"
# main function ˘Ô≈ôﺣ
function main() {
# always show the config values
showConfValues
# check that all needed values are set
# clone all needed repos
if checkConfValues && cloneRepos; then
# move the files and folders
moveFoldersFiles
# crazy but lets check anyway
if [ -d "${ROOT_TARGET_FOLDER}" ]; then
# move to root target folder
cd "${ROOT_TARGET_FOLDER}" || exit 24
# merge all changes
if mergeChanges; then
# check what action to take to get
# the changes into the target repository
if (("$TARGET_REPO_ACTION" == 1)); then
# we must merge directly to target
makeMergeToTarget
else
# we should create a pull request
makePullRequestAgainstTarget
fi
# check if all went well
if [ $? -eq 0 ]; then
# give the final success message
finalMessage "========= Successfully synced ========================" ">=>"
fi
else
# show that there was noting to do...
finalMessage "========= Tried to sync (but nothing changed) ========" "==="
fi
fi
fi
echo "There was a serious error."
exit 22
}
# show the configuration values
function checkConfValues() {
# check if we have found errors
local ERROR=0
# make sure SOURCE_REPO is set
[[ ! "${SOURCE_REPO}" == *"/"* ]] && _echo "SOURCE_REPO:${SOURCE_REPO} is not a repo path!" && ERROR=1
[[ ! $(wget -S --spider "https://github.com/${SOURCE_REPO}" 2>&1 | grep 'HTTP/1.1 200 OK') ]] &&
_echo "SOURCE_REPO:https://github.com/${SOURCE_REPO} is not set correctly, or the github user does not have access!" &&
ERROR=1
# make sure SOURCE_REPO_BRANCH is set
[ ${#SOURCE_REPO_BRANCH} -le 1 ] && _echo "SOURCE_REPO_BRANCH:${SOURCE_REPO_BRANCH} is not set correctly!" && ERROR=1
# make sure SOURCE_REPO_FOLDERS is set
[ ${#SOURCE_REPO_FOLDERS} -le 1 ] && _echo "SOURCE_REPO_FOLDERS:${SOURCE_REPO_FOLDERS} is not set correctly!" && ERROR=1
# make sure TARGET_REPO is set
[[ ! "${TARGET_REPO}" == *"/"* ]] && _echo "TARGET_REPO:${TARGET_REPO} is not a repo path!" && ERROR=1
[[ ! $(wget -S --spider "https://github.com/${TARGET_REPO}" 2>&1 | grep 'HTTP/1.1 200 OK') ]] &&
_echo "TARGET_REPO:https://github.com/${TARGET_REPO} is not set correctly, or the github user does not have access!" &&
ERROR=1
# make sure TARGET_REPO_BRANCH is set
[ ${#TARGET_REPO_BRANCH} -le 1 ] && _echo "TARGET_REPO_BRANCH:${TARGET_REPO_BRANCH} is not set correctly!" && ERROR=1
# make sure TARGET_REPO_FOLDERS is set
[ ${#TARGET_REPO_FOLDERS} -le 1 ] && _echo "TARGET_REPO_FOLDERS:${TARGET_REPO_FOLDERS} is not set correctly!" && ERROR=1
# check that the correct action is set
! (("$TARGET_REPO_ACTION" == 1)) && ! (("$TARGET_REPO_ACTION" == 0)) && _echo "TARGET_REPO_ACTION:${TARGET_REPO_ACTION} is not set correctly!" && ERROR=1
# make sure TARGET_REPO_FORK is set correctly if set
if [ ${#TARGET_REPO_FORK} -ge 1 ]; then
[[ ! "${TARGET_REPO_FORK}" == *"/"* ]] && _echo "TARGET_REPO_FORK:${TARGET_REPO_FORK} is not a repo path!" && ERROR=1
[[ ! $(wget -S --spider "https://github.com/${TARGET_REPO_FORK}" 2>&1 | grep 'HTTP/1.1 200 OK') ]] &&
_echo "TARGET_REPO_FORK:https://github.com/${TARGET_REPO_FORK} is not set correctly, or the github user does not have access!" &&
ERROR=1
fi
# if error found exit
(("$ERROR" == 1)) && exit 19
return 0
}
# clone the repo
function cloneRepos() {
# clone the source repo (we don't need access on this one)
[[ "${SOURCE_REPO}" == *"/"* ]] && cloneRepo "https://github.com/${SOURCE_REPO}.git" "${SOURCE_REPO_BRANCH}" "${ROOT_SOURCE_FOLDER}"
# clone the forked target repo if set
if [[ "${TARGET_REPO_FORK}" == *"/"* ]]; then
# we need access on this one, so we use git@github.com:
cloneRepo "git@github.com:${TARGET_REPO_FORK}.git" "${TARGET_REPO_BRANCH}" "${ROOT_TARGET_FOLDER}"
# only rebase if fresh clone
if [ $? -eq 0 ]; then
# rebase with upstream (we don't need access on this one)
rebaseWithUpstream "https://github.com/${TARGET_REPO}.git" "${TARGET_REPO_BRANCH}" "${ROOT_TARGET_FOLDER}"
fi
# we must have merge set if we directly work with target repo
elif (("$TARGET_REPO_ACTION" == 1)); then
# we need access on this one, so we use git@github.com:
cloneRepo "${TARGET_REPO}" "git@github.com:${TARGET_REPO_BRANCH}.git" "${ROOT_TARGET_FOLDER}"
else
_echo "You use a forked target (target.repo.fork=org/forked_repo) or set the (target.repo.merge=1) to merge directly into target."
exit 20
fi
return 0
}
# clone the repo
function cloneRepo() {
# set local values
local git_repo="$1"
local git_branch="$2"
local git_folder="$3"
# with test we don't clone again
# if folder already exist (if you dont want this behaviour manually remove the folders)
if (("$TEST" == 1)) && [ -d "${git_folder}" ]; then
_echo "folder:${git_folder} already exist, repo:${git_repo} was not cloned again. (test mode)"
return 1
else
# make sure the folder does not exist
[ -d "${git_folder}" ] && rm -fr "${git_folder}"
# clone the repo (but only a single branch)
git clone -b "$git_branch" --single-branch "$git_repo" "$git_folder"
if [ $? -eq 0 ]; then
_echo "${git_repo} was cloned successfully."
else
_echo "${git_repo} failed to cloned successfully, check that the GitHub user has access to this repo!"
exit 21
fi
fi
return 0
}
# rebase repo with its upstream
function rebaseWithUpstream() {
# current folder
local current_folder=$PWD
# set local values
local git_repo_upstream="$1"
local git_branch="$2"
local git_folder="$3"
# just a random remote name
local git_upstream="stroomOp"
# go into repo folder
cd "${git_folder}" || exit 23
# check out the upstream repository
git checkout -b "${git_upstream}" "$git_branch"
git pull "${git_repo_upstream}" "$git_branch"
if [ $? -eq 0 ]; then
_echo "upstream:${git_repo_upstream} was pulled successfully."
else
_echo "Failed to pull upstream:${git_repo_upstream} successfully, check that the GitHub user has access to this repo!"
exit 10
fi
# make sure we are on the targeted branch
git checkout "$git_branch"
# rebase to upstream
git rebase "${git_upstream}"
if [ $? -eq 0 ]; then
_echo "upstream:${git_repo_upstream} was rebased into the forked repo successfully."
else
_echo "Failed to rebase upstream:${git_repo_upstream} successfully!"
exit 12
fi
# make sure this is not a test
if (("$TEST" == 1)); then
_echo "The forked repo of upstream:${git_repo_upstream} not updated, as this is a test."
else
# force update the forked repo
git push origin "$git_branch" --force
if [ $? -eq 0 ]; then
_echo "The forked repo of upstream:${git_repo_upstream} successfully updated."
else
_echo "Failed to update the forked repo, check that the GitHub user has access to this repo!"
exit 13
fi
fi
# return to original folder
cd "${current_folder}" || exit 24
return 0
}

# help message ʕ•ᴥ•ʔ
function show_help() {
cat <<EOF
Usage: ${0##*/:-} [OPTION...]
Options
======================================================
--conf=<path>
set all the config properties with a file
properties examples are:
source.repo.path=[org]/[repo]
source.repo.branch=[branch]
source.repo.folders=[folder/path_a;folder/path_b]
source.repo.files=[0;a-file.js,b-file.js]
target.repo.path=[org]/[repo]
target.repo.branch=[branch]
target.repo.folders=[folder/path_a;folder/path_b]
# To merge or just make a PR (0 = PR; 1 = Merge)
target.repo.merge=1
# Target fork is rebased then updated and used to make a PR or Merge
target.repo.fork=[org]/[repo]
see: conf/example
example: ${0##*/:-} --conf=/home/$USER/.config/repos-to-sync.conf
======================================================
--source-path=[org]/[repo]
set the source repository path as found on github (for now)
example: ${0##*/:-} --source-path=Octoleo/Octosync
======================================================
--source-branch=[branch-name]
set the source repository branch name
example: ${0##*/:-} --source-branch=master
======================================================
--source-folders=[folder-path]
set the source folder path
separate multiple paths with a semicolon
example: ${0##*/:-} --source-folders=folder/path1;folder/path2
======================================================
--source-files=[files]
set the source files
omitting this will sync all files in the folders
separate multiple folders files with a semicolon
separate multiple files in a folder with a comma
each set of files will require the same number(position) path in the --source-folders
[dynamic options]
setting a 0 in a position will allow all files & sub-folders of that folder to be synced
setting a 1 in a position will allow only all files in that folder to be synced
setting a 2 in a position will allow only all sub-folders in that folder to be synced
see: conf/example (more details)
example: ${0##*/:-} --source-files=file.txt,file2.txt;0
======================================================
--target-path=[org]/[repo]
set the target repository path as found on github (for now)
example: ${0##*/:-} --target-path=MyOrg/Octosync
======================================================
--target-branch=[branch-name]
set the target repository branch name
example: ${0##*/:-} --target-branch=master
======================================================
--target-folders=[folder-path]
set the target folder path
separate multiple paths with a semicolon
example: ${0##*/:-} --target-folders=folder/path1;folder/path2
======================================================
--target-fork=[org]/[repo]
set the target fork repository path as found on github (for now)
the target fork is rebased then updated and used to make a PR or Merge
example: ${0##*/:-} --target-fork=MyOrg/Octosync
======================================================
-m | --target-repo-merge | --target-merge
force direct merge behaviour if permissions allow
example: ${0##*/:-} -m
======================================================
-pr | --target-repo-pull-request | --target-pull-request
create a pull request instead of a direct merge if permissions allow
example: ${0##*/:-} -pr
======================================================
--target-token=xx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xx
pass the token needed to merge or create a pull request on the target repo
example: ${0##*/:-} --target-token=xx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xx
======================================================
--test
activate the test behaviour
example: ${0##*/:-} --test
======================================================
--dry
To show all configuration, and not update repos
example: ${0##*/:-} --dry
======================================================
-h|--help
display this help menu
example: ${0##*/:-} -h
example: ${0##*/:-} --help
======================================================
${BOT_NAME}
======================================================
EOF
}
